OREANDA-NEWS. Hitachi, Ltd. and Hitachi Consulting Co., Ltd. announced today that as of December 1, they will begin sales of "Transformation Support Services," which support fundamental structural reforms for Japanese companies rolling out business on a global scale.

Transformation Support Services utilize the expertise through the Hitachi Smart Transformation Project, which targets structural reforms throughout the Hitachi Group.

Transformation Support Services offer from upstream consulting regarding overall project planning for structural reforms to a variety of solutions/ services in value chain including supply chain management system ("SCM"), global procurement logistics services, etc., to help manufacturing companies execute structural reforms.

The Hitachi Group has been executing drastic cost structure reforms under the title of the "Hitachi Smart Transformation Project." The goal of these activities is to reduce the total cost of sales in FY2015 by 420 billion yen compared to FY2010. From FY2011 to FY2014, on a cumulative basis, indirect costs were reduced by 150 billion yen while production costs and direct material costs were reduced by 170 billion yen, for total cost reductions of 320 billion yen (compared to FY2010). Additional cost reductions of 100 billion yen are expected to be achieved in FY2015.

The Hitachi Group is currently strengthening these activities, for example by reforming end-to-end work processes in the supply chain from business inquiry to receiving orders, production, and service, and implementing reforms aimed at generating cash, in order to reduce costs even further.
